Output 5c00926891df62ab0ae0411e4109881ae58b92aa8aa583533af93f2b24ab343e:14

value
19965706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324638bb643d87c634708e9ffaef82e581cc85e8 OP_EQUAL
address
MCUz972LraG7juQcER35cccdPSzkHd3H9p
transaction
5c00926891df62ab0ae0411e4109881ae58b92aa8aa583533af93f2b24ab343e
spent
true